Swap a Sump Pump Battery Easily

Replacing your sump pump battery is {astraightforward task that you can do on your own with only basic tools. First, discover the battery compartment on your sump pump. It's usually located near the side. Next, remove the power cord to the sump pump for security.

Slowly remove the old battery and inspect its terminals for any corrosion. If the terminals are corroded, scrub them with a wire brush and baking soda solution. Once you've installed the new battery, re-connect the power cord to the sump pump.

Double check that the battery terminals are securely connected and then test the sump pump to make certain it's working properly.

Amplify Your Sump Pump Protection: Battery Swapping

Keeping your sump pump operational during power outages is essential for protecting your basement from flooding. Regular battery checks can ensure your backup system is always ready when you need it most. Check your sump pump's manual for recommended battery types and lifespans. Consider creating a routine for battery review every three months, and don't hesitate to swap the batteries if they show signs of deterioration.
